  • 정부 주도의 대규모 개발사업은 개발과 환경보전이라는 가치관의 차이, 개발로 인한 공익과 환경 파괴로 인한 환경이익 침해와 같은 공익 간의 상충, 사업으로 예상되는 국익과 개인의 재산권 침해 등과 같은 문제를 초래하는 경우가 많았다. 그럼에도 불구하고 정부는 개발정책과 계획을 수립하고 개발사업을 집행하는 과정에서 발생되는 자연훼손이나 환경파괴, 경제적 타당성, 사회적 문제 등을 객관적이고 과학적으로 조사하거나 제대로 검증하지 않아 갈등이 빈번하게 발생하였다. 이러한 갈등을 해결하기 위한 기존의 연구는 대개 갈등의 원인을 이해관계, 가치관, 사실관계, 제도 측면에서 규명하고 해결방안으로 주로 주민참여와 거버넌스, 전략환경평가, 사회영향평가 등을 제시하였다. 본 연구에서는 한국에서 1980년대 중반이후 주요 개발갈등사례를 개발사업 종류, 갈등당사자, 갈등 쟁점, 갈등 원인, 선거공약 여부, 소송 여부에 따라 정리한 후, 갈등 예방과 해소를 위한 법과 제도를 고찰하였다. 그리고 선거공약 또는 개발정책 및 계획안 구상단계, 개발정책 및 개발계획 수립 단계, 개발사업 시행단계, 갈등 분쟁 발생단계 등으로 구분하여 갈등예방 및 해소방안을 제시하였다. 선거공약 단계에서는 공직선거법상 선거공약서 규정에 국가재정법상 예비타당성분석을 도입하고, 개발정책 및 개발계획 수립단계에서는 전략환경평가와 갈등영향평가의 연계, 전략환경평가과정에 사회영향평가 및 주민참여의 강화, 환경계획과 개발계획의 연계 등을 제시하였다. 개발사업 시행 단계에서는 환경영향평가 과정에서의 주민참여를 강화하고, 개발사업 시행단계에서 갈등이 발생하는 경우 거버넌스 구축과 환경분쟁조정법, 공공기관의 갈등예방과 해결에 관한 규정 등을 근거로 하는 갈등해소방안을 제시하였다.

  • 본 논문에서는 도시 개발현장의 재해저감시설 중 하나인 침사지겸 저류지의 효과평가를 위한 모니터링 방안을 제시하였다. 전 지구적으로 기온이 급격히 상승하고 있으며 이상 자연현상이 지속적으로 증가하고 있다. 특히 우리나라는 매년 태풍에 영향을 받고 여름에 강수량이 집중되고 있다. 개발 중 지표면이 침식에 노출되고 불투수면적의 증가로 홍수위험이 높아져 재해영향평가제도에 따라 침사지겸 저류지를 설치하여 토사의 하천 유출을 방지하고, 첨두유출을 완화시키고 있다. 설치 시 외국의 경험식과 재해영향평가서 기준 기상청 관측대의 30년 빈도 강우량을 사용하고 있으나, 유형 및 제원의 적절성의 효과평가 방안이 부재하다. 향후 이상기후로 강하고 잦은 폭우가 예상되며, 이로 인한 홍수 피해를 예방하기 위한 침사지겸 저류지에 대한 효과 평가 방안이 필요하다. 이에 침사지겸 저류지의 재해저감 효과평가를 위해 타 재해저감시설 모니터링 체계 분석을 통해 수위값과 퇴사위 계측을 활용한 침사지 겸 저류지의 모니터링 방안을 도출하였다.

  • 기상학적 측면에서 강수 부족으로 인한 수생태환경(하천), 호소환경(저수지) 및 유역환경(중권역)으로 미치는 환경학적 가뭄의 영향을 평가하기 위한 시도는 매우 중요하다. 만약 동일한 규모의 강수부족 현상이 발생할지라도, 환경적 측면에서의 수질 및 수생태에 미치는 영향이 매우 큰 유역이 있고, 반면 어느 정도의 복원력을 유지할 수 있는 유역이 있을 것이다. 즉, 서로 다른 유역환경에 따라 가뭄으로 인한 환경적 영향은 달라질 가능성이 크며, 이처럼 환경적 가뭄에 취약한 지역을 위해서는 지속적인 환경가뭄 모니터링이 중요하다. 환경적 측면에서 가뭄의 영향을 평가하기 위해서는 다양한 수질 관련 항목을 연계한 환경가뭄 감시가 중요하며, 이와 더불어 가뭄과 관련한 다양한 이해관계자 간의 효율적인 의사결정 도구가 필요하다. 따라서 본 연구에서는 다양한 시나리오 정보를 제공할 수 있는 베이지안 네트워크 모형을 적용하여 환경가뭄 민감도 평가 방안을 제시하고자 한다. 본 모형에서는 수질 문제가 가장 심하게 대두되고 있는 낙동강 유역을 대상으로, 기상학적 가뭄에 의한 수생태 및 환경 관련 변수들(BOD, T-P, TOC)의 복잡한 상호의존성을 파악할 수 있는 베이지안 네트워크 모형을 활용하였다. 또한, 기상학적 가뭄에 의한 상류와 하류 간의 환경적 영향을 연계하여 해석하기 위한 모형을 구축하였다. 그 결과, 기상학적 가뭄으로 인한 환경적 민감도가 크게 나타나는 중권역(예: 임하댐유역)과 이와 반대인 중권역(예: 병성천유역)의 구분이 가능하였다. 또한, 상류에서 발생한 심한 기상학적 가뭄이 하류 지역 내 환경적인 영향을 지속할 가능성이 있음을 확인되었다. 따라서 본 연구에서 제안한 방법은 환경적 가뭄의 취약지역을 우선 선정하고, 나아가 상-하류 간의 환경적 가뭄을 감시하는 데 있어 활용도가 있을 것으로 기대된다.

  • Environmental impact assessment has been performed as preliminary assessment system in order to conserve environment value and minimize negative effect from development. Assessment based on data has been necessary to strengthen objectivity in process of Environmental impact assessment process. Furthermore extended use of spatial information in Environmental impact assessment system has been required through spatial information provided at government level and possibility connected with spatial information in Environmental impact assessment. However spatial information has not been systematically utilized in current Environmental impact assessment. Also the environmental impact assessment workers including assessment government employees, agencies of Environmental impact assessment document and review agencies lack an understanding in the concept of spatial information, so there is limit about their use to efficiently. In order to improve these limits in use of spatial information, this study suggested measures to standardize spatial information (coordinate and attribute table). To do so, based on coordinate and standards certified by the government, this study defined standard coordinates (GRS-80, central datum point, False East: 100000, False North: 200000) and established 9 default items. Lastly, the aforementioned standards were tested for actual environmental impact assessment projects. Standardization measures suggested in this study are expected to contribute to invigorate spatial information utilization in Environmental impact assessment and expand the scope of the assessment.

  • Mitigation measures in EIS are the important factors in the effectiveness of EIS. This paper analyzed the content of mitigation measures described in the 30 EISs selected, using 7 analysis items in order to discover the degree of effectiveness of mitigation measures. 30 EISs used in this study were selected through variance maximization strategy, and the 7 analysis items were; 1) thoroughness of mitigation content, 2) quantification of mitigation content, 3) explicit description of mitigation effect, 4) likelihood of mitigation effect, 5) impacted area of mitigation effect, 6) time frame of mitigation effect, and 7) environmental impact of mitigation measures. The results showed that the effectiveness of mitigation measures in the analyzed EISs was relatively low both in the appropriateness and in the specificity. It was suggested that in order to improve the appropriateness of EIS as a decision making tool, the effect of mitigation measures, as well as the mitigation measures themselves, should be studied and described more thoroughly and specifically.

  • Muju Resort Development environmental impact statement(EIS) in Mt. Teogyu National Park are evaluated with the results of post-environmental evaluation. Three EIA items (ecosystem, hydrology, landuse) are investigated. In terms of ecosystem and hydrology, the environment during construction period was compared with post-construction and it was also true of hydrology section. The land use surrounding the resort area have been changed seriously, and the wildlife in large patch are endangered with the fragmentation by road and resort construction. The three items in the Muju Resort EIS was not assessed properly. So, in order to assess properly accurate data, appropriate approach, and periodical post evaluation are required.

  • The way we work is changing significantly with the rapid development of digitaltechnology, and paper documents are being replaced by electronic documents. However, in accordance with the Enforcement Decree and Enforcement Regulation of the Environmental Impact Assessment Act, the environmental impact assessment report must submit a set number of paper reports to organizations related to the project, and about 42 years have passed since it was submitted as a paperreport. In 2022, the National Institute of Ecology introduced a system to review paperreports as electronic documents in line with the trend of digital transformation. The cost reduction and carbon emission reduction effects of electronic document review were analyzed for 1,398 environmental impact assessments submitted and reviewed in 2022. In addition, a satisfaction survey was conducted targeting type 1 environmental impact assessment companies that were directly affected, and a total of 134 people responded. As a result of analyzing the effect of reviewing electronic documents, costs are reduced by a total of 101,424,900 won per year and carbon emissions are reduced by about 59.7 tons. As a result of the satisfaction survey, 94.8% of the respondents said electronic documentreview was very helpful, and 4.5% said it was helpful. The effectiveness of electronic documentreview was high, with 94.8% of respondents saying it was helpful in economic terms and 91.8% saying it was helpful in reducing work hours. If electronic documents are reviewed through the revisions to the Enforcement Decree and Enforcement Regulation of the Environmental Impact Assessment Act, the implementation of electronic document review is expected to have a ripple effect across the country, not only reducing costs and carbon emissions, but also reducing administrative time and saving storage space. Rapid changes in law and administration are needed to adapt to the digital transformation era.

  • Recently, local governments have recognized river zones as leisure spaces and local festival venues, and hence, the pressure for developing these zones has increased significantly. However, given the unique functionalities of river zones and the time and costs associated with maintaining facilities and restoring damaged areas, a development plan must be selected carefully. To preserve river zones and to facilitate nature-friendly space utilization, this study focused on improving environmental impact assessment (EIA), which is an institutional implementation procedure for project plans. This study prepared a draft guide for EIA by providing an overview of the research background and survey outcomes, including the status of laws and regulations on river zones, development plans, and opinions on EIA. The results showed that because strategic EIA of basic river plans is important for district designation of river zones and the scope and direction of space utilization, it is necessary to establish a more meticulous business plan before reviewing and evaluating the mini EIA linked to the future implementation of a plan to derive a reasonable assessment. Additionally, this study provides a draft guide for EIA to evaluate the suitability of water-friendly facility construction plans considering the location characteristics and to reflect the factors that can reduce the environmental impacts during the mini EIA stage. In the future, we expect that the results of this study will serve as a foundation for establishing instructions and guides for the development of nature-friendly and water-friendly facilities in river zones during the establishment of plans.
